What does furnace maintenance include?

Our 21-point tune-up includes heat exchanger inspection, burner cleaning, blower motor service, electrical connection tightening, thermostat calibration, safety control testing, and carbon monoxide check. San Leandro furnaces see their heaviest use from November through February, when Bay Area overnight lows drop into the low 40s and gas bills rise sharply. Pre-season maintenance — heat exchanger integrity check, burner cleaning, blower motor condition review, and gas pressure verification — prevents the most common mid-winter failures. What Furnace Maintenance Services Do You Offer in San Leandro?

21-Point Furnace Tune-Up

Our comprehensive tune-up covers all critical components including heat exchanger inspection, burner cleaning, blower motor service, and safety testing to ensure reliable operation.

  • Heat exchanger inspection
  • Burner cleaning and adjustment
  • Blower motor lubrication
  • Safety control testing
  • Thermostat calibration
  • Carbon monoxide testing

Efficiency Testing

We measure combustion efficiency and check for proper airflow to ensure your furnace is operating at its rated efficiency, saving you money on energy bills.

  • Combustion analysis
  • Airflow measurement
  • Efficiency rating verification
  • Recommendations for improvement

Maintain Your Warranty

Most manufacturers require annual maintenance to keep warranties valid. Our tune-ups provide documentation to protect your investment.
